- Main Text: Organize the main text into sections such as Introduction, Methods, Results, Discussion, and Conclusion. Use subheadings to structure the content where necessary.
- Introduction: Clearly state the research question, objectives, and significance of the study. Provide background information and a brief review of relevant literature.
- Methods: Describe the study design, data collection procedures, and analysis methods in detail. Ensure that the methods are transparent and reproducible.
- Results: Present the findings of the study, using tables and figures to illustrate key points. Avoid interpreting the results in this section.
- Discussion: Interpret the findings in the context of existing research, discuss the implications, and highlight any limitations of the study.
- Conclusion: Summarize the main findings and suggest potential directions for future research.

3. Peer Review Process
Initial Screening
- All submissions undergo an initial screening by the editorial board to ensure they meet the journal's scope and standards. Manuscripts that do not conform to the journal’s guidelines or are outside the scope will be returned to the authors without review.
Double-Blind Review
- Anandam follows a double-blind peer review process, where both reviewers and authors remain anonymous to each other. At least two independent reviewers will evaluate each manuscript. Reviewers are selected based on their expertise and their ability to provide an unbiased assessment of the manuscript.
Reviewer Feedback
- Reviewers will provide constructive feedback and recommendations on the manuscript. The editorial board will consider the reviewers’ comments and make a final decision on the manuscript.
Review Timeline
- Authors will be notified of the review decision within 8-12 weeks of submission. The decision may be acceptance, minor revisions, major revisions, or rejection.
Revisions
- Authors are expected to revise their manuscripts based on the reviewers’ comments and resubmit them for further evaluation. The revised manuscript should be accompanied by a detailed response to the reviewers’ comments.
